21-year-old worker hit by equipment dies at Richland construction site
A 21-year-old man died at a Richland construction site after being hit by a front loader.
The man, whose name has not been released, was working at the Westcliffe Heights subdivision near the corner of Epic Street and Ascend Street about 9:30 a.m. on Friday.
Deputy Coroner Dennis Morris said the employee died at the scene.
Details were not immediately available about how it occurred.
The Department of Labor and Industries is investigating and will determine if an autopsy needs to be done.
The luxury housing construction project on Little Badger Mountain is being developed by Pahlisch Homes. Prices start about $726,000, according to the website.
